Skarbona [skarˈbɔna] (German Birkendorf) is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Maszewo, within Krosno Odrzańskie County, Lubusz Voivodeship, in western Poland.[1] It lies approximately 6 kilometres (4 mi) north of Maszewo, 17 km (11 mi) north-west of Krosno Odrzańskie, 46 km (29 mi) north-west of Zielona Góra, and 73 km (45 mi) south of Gorzów Wielkopolski.

Before 1945 the area was part of Germany (see Territorial changes of Poland after World War II).
